Steve Cody joins On Top of PR host Jason Mudd to discuss Steve’s book, “The ROI of LOL,” and how effective comedy within the workplace is.


Guest:

Steve is the author of “The ROI of LOL: How Laughter Breaks Down Walls, Drives Compelling Storytelling, and Creates a Healthy Workplace.” He’s also a comedian, climber, and dog lover, but not necessarily in that order.

Five things you’ll learn from this episode:

  1. What compelled Steve to write “The ROI of LOL” 
  2. The reaction of comedy in the workplace
  3. Why humor/laughter is so important for companies 
  4. How a company can measure the ROI of LOL
  5. Where the implementation of comedy in an organization can occur

About Steve Cody

Steve Cody is a multifaceted individual, blending his love for climbing, comedy, and writing. From summiting the highest peaks in Africa and Europe to raising over $50,000 for charities through stand-up comedy shows, he finds pride in diverse accomplishments. Additionally, as a writer, he contributes to Inc.com, maintains a daily blog, and has made notable appearances on CNBC, MSNBC, NPR, and other prominent media outlets, as well as authoring his book: "The ROI of LOL."
